From 49604b425978fca1a0b197ff5d43889d33ffcb87 Mon Sep 17 00:00:00 2001 From: julian Date: Fri, 28 Apr 2000 17:09:00 +0000 Subject: Two simple changes to the kernel internal API for netgraph modules, to support future work in flow-control and 'packet reject/replace' processing modes. reviewed by: phk, archie --- sys/netgraph/ng_rfc1490.c | 5 +++-- 1 file changed, 3 insertions(+), 2 deletions(-) (limited to 'sys/netgraph/ng_rfc1490.c') diff --git a/sys/netgraph/ng_rfc1490.c b/sys/netgraph/ng_rfc1490.c index f14e74b..bc7edb8 100644 --- a/sys/netgraph/ng_rfc1490.c +++ b/sys/netgraph/ng_rfc1490.c @@ -172,7 +172,7 @@ ng_rfc1490_newhook(node_p node, hook_p hook, const char *name) */ static int ng_rfc1490_rcvmsg(node_p node, struct ng_mesg *msg, - const char *raddr, struct ng_mesg **rp) + const char *raddr, struct ng_mesg **rp, hook_p lasthook) { FREE(msg, M_NETGRAPH); return (EINVAL); @@ -215,7 +215,8 @@ ng_rfc1490_rcvmsg(node_p node, struct ng_mesg *msg, #define OUICMP(P,A,B,C) ((P)[0]==(A) && (P)[1]==(B) && (P)[2]==(C)) static int -ng_rfc1490_rcvdata(hook_p hook, struct mbuf *m, meta_p meta) +ng_rfc1490_rcvdata(hook_p hook, struct mbuf *m, meta_p meta, + struct mbuf **ret_m, meta_p *ret_meta) { const node_p node = hook->node; const priv_p priv = node->private; -- cgit v1.1